I'm not an MSU fan, but I figure if Michigan gets one of these threads, State should as well. Right now they are the dominant program in the state, and after years of excelling with lower-rated players, MSU's recruiting is starting to reflect its on-field success, with Mark Dantonio pulling in his best class ever in 2015 (by Rivals avg. star ranking). He appears to be off to a good start in 2016 too:
